The Bard Nursing Team

Our team of fully qualified, experienced specialist nurses, provides clinical and educational support for continence management, including indwelling catheter issues, tuition of Intermittent Self Catheterisation (ISC) and the assessment and fitting of urinary sheaths, to both patients and healthcare professionals.

The Bard Specialist Nurses will accept referrals from NHS professionals to support their patients.  Each nurse is qualified and competent to carry out bladder scanning and patient assessment as well as giving advice and training on all prescribed continence products.  Our nurses can also offer educational study days and / or nursing support for ISC, Indwelling catheters and sheath assessment.  Our nurses will also undertake joint visits with a Healthcare Professional if requested.

PROFESSIONAL MEMBERSHIP
The team are RGN/RN qualified and registered with the Nursing and Midwifery Council following the Professional Code of Conduct at all times.  They are also members of the Royal College of Nursing.

EDUCATION
All nurses have a continence or urology background and undergo an appraisal process twice yearly to identify areas for development.  Attendance at national conferences ensures they are updated with the latest practices and innovations.

RISK ANALYSIS
All patient visits are risk assessed, to determine if a joint visit is required.  The nursing service has a risk analysis procedure to identify any risks which may become evident during an episode of clinical care.  This risk may be to the patient, healthcare professional or anyone else involved in the patient’s care.

RECORD KEEPING
Nursing notes are compiled for all patients referred to the Bard Nursing Service.  These are stored electronically and held according to the regulations of the Data Protection Act.

INSURANCE
Each nurse has indemnity insurance to cover against claims of professional negligence.

DISCLOSURE AND BARRING ALL SERVICE (DBS)
In line with current legislation all nurses are DBS checked prior to employment.
